Ebben a programban megtanulja megtalálni a karakter ASCII értékét és megjeleníteni.
A példa megértéséhez ismernie kell a következő Python programozási témákat:
- Beépített Python programozási funkciók
- Python bevitel, kimenet és importálás
Az ASCII az amerikai szabványos információcsere szabványt jelenti.
Ez egy numerikus érték, amelyet különféle karaktereknek és szimbólumoknak adnak meg a számítógépek tárolásra és kezelésre. Például a levél ASCII értéke 'A'
65.
Forráskód
# Program to find the ASCII value of the given character c = 'p' print("The ASCII value of '" + c + "' is", ord(c))
Kimenet
A „p” ASCII értéke 112
Megjegyzés: A program más karakterek teszteléséhez módosítsa a c
változóhoz rendelt karaktert .
Itt ord()
függvényt használtunk arra, hogy egy karaktert egész számgá alakítsunk át (ASCII érték). Ez a függvény az adott karakter Unicode kódpontját adja vissza.
Az Unicode egy olyan kódolási technika is, amely egyedi számot ad egy karakter számára. Míg az ASCII csak 128 karaktert kódol, a jelenlegi Unicode több mint 100 000 karaktert tartalmaz több száz szkriptből.
Az Ön sora: Módosítsa a fenti kódot, hogy a chr () függvény használatával karaktereket kapjon a hozzájuk tartozó ASCII értékekből, az alábbiak szerint.
>>> chr (65) 'A' >>> chr (120) 'x' >>> chr (ord ('S') + 1) 'T'
Itt vannak, ord()
és chr()
beépített funkciók. Látogasson el ide, ha többet szeretne megtudni a Python beépített funkcióiról.